Path Finder
Nov 20 2009

JQMUSICMAN  Path Finder aspires to be something beautiful... and it succeeds on many levels --- except one. Stability. The devs are super-friendly and helpful --- but they can't seem to make their software stable. I've installed a few different versions of Path Finder over a period time hoping the bugs would be gone and the results have always been the same --- unreliable performance. Most notably are random crashes and freezes, especially when "hiding" the application. There are other minor annoyances that I could easily overlook, but the stability issue just can't be ignored. I've sent crash reports and have traded emails with support several times and I know they're trying hard. I'll keep my fingers crossed that they'll eventually get the large issue fixed because Path Finder would be dream come true. As it is, I find it unusable :(

BatchOutput
Oct 15 2007
*****

JQMUSICMAN  Zevrix Solutions has created a great app here that fills a missing gap in InDesign. I was seeking a tool that would help me in a very specific situation when I found Batch Output. It saved me enough time the first use to justify the cost. I've since found this versatile and powerful for many situations. Also, I sent a feature request to the dev and got a personal reply within about a day offering what I took as a genuine "thank you". That's a first for me. If you're looking for a solid app that offers total control of your InDesign output, I'm betting this will work for you.
